Cyclist seriously injured in collision with car in Graz
Monday 17th August 2026 on 19:00 in
Austria
A cyclist was seriously injured in a collision with a car in Graz’s Andritz district, ORF reported. Police are asking witnesses to come forward.
The crash happened at about 6 p.m. at the junction of Weinzöttlstraße and Am Andritzbach. According to initial findings, a 37-year-old driver from Voitsberg was turning right into Weinzöttlstraße towards the outskirts of the city.
At the same time, a 41-year-old cyclist from Graz was travelling on the shared footpath and cycle path along Weinzöttlstraße. He was crossing the junction straight ahead towards the city centre.
The driver apparently failed to see the cyclist. The cyclist then collided with the car, fell onto the road and suffered serious injuries.
The traffic police are asking anyone with information about the accident to call 059133 654110.
